that looks a bit like you try to use nfs here, unlike the
squashfs/unionfs setup the rootfs wont be writeable if you dont add dirs
and files to the bind_mounts variables used
from /etc/default/ltsp-client-setup inside the chroot ... i'd really
suggest using the unionfs setup we run as default, it will save you a
lot of hassle.
